Fyi...The stock setup is definitely slower than the SG-1203 tank but it does much better in deep snow.
Blizzard has 370 motors
SG has 390 motor and 130 motor.

Both are obviously no comparison to my Typhon v2 in terms of speed haha
Blizzard is pretty expensive, too.
Blizzard = +/-300 USD
SG = +/- 60 USD

Santa delivered 3 Kraton 6s' and a plethora of upgrade/spare parts. One for each boy and of course one for myself. Newish to the hobby and now the fun begins. First Kraton doesn't turn anymore. I've trying to troubleshoot. I get very small movement on the servo but nothing more. 2nd Kraton will not go in reverse and 3rd one is fine so far.

I bought Hitec HS-7955TG servos to upgrade but I was hoping to troubleshoot the problem before replacing it. Any suggestions?
Disconnect the servo arm on the stocker servo and observe its travel and speed. Plug in the new Hitec off the rig uninstalled and observe the difference.
